Action item: The Relayn deploy-status bot silently dropped updates when the pipeline API paginated results, so responders believed a rollback had completed when it had not. We will add pagination handling, a staleness banner, and an integration test. Until merged, verify deploy state directly in the pipeline console, documented at the page below.

runbook for kahop-kajop: https://rundeck.ordinio.test/display/secrets/pipeline/issue/pages/repo/browse/e5732776e07d1285107e5aeb

Multi-column sorts apply right-to-left; plugins injecting custom comparators must be deterministic or row order will drift between renders. Known issue: null handling differs between the preview and export engines — see the sorting FAQ before filing a report. Include your plugin version, a minimal dataset, and both preview and export output when reporting. For comparator contract questions or to report nondeterministic ordering, reach the Tallygrid plugin support desk.

escalation mailbox, bafog-fafog: ulador@paliqlabs.internal

## Build Provenance — Splitwise Assignment Service

Every deploy of the Splitwise experiment-assignment service is built by the Kestrel pipeline, which records the source revision, builder image, and dependency lockfile digest. New team members should verify provenance before debugging assignment skew, since stale builds are the most common cause. The provenance record is attached to each artifact in the Larkspur registry. The token below identifies the exact build under investigation.

pipeline stamp: htk31_f769b577b3028a4e9958e5bb8d1259a